EarlyPrototype wrote:Di Stefano not achieving success internationally.
But he played for like 3 NTs no? What's the story on that?

Long story short:

Argentina refused to participate in what would have been his first world cup.

He missed what would've been his second through injury.

Mass footballer strikes in Argentina forced Di Stefano to migrate to Columbia to make a living. Problem was Colombia wasn't recognised by FIFA. Missed what would've been his third.

Moved to Spain.

Became Spanish national when he was probably past his prime. Spain didn't qualify for what would've been his last world cup.

I recalling these off the top of my head, so I could be wrong with the order/details but it was something like that.
I see, damn roller coaster ride of a national career.

Schalke 04 losing the BL Championship in 2001. They lost out to a goal by Bayern that was scored in the 3rd minute of injury time in the very last match of that season. Ever since then, Schalke are known as "Champions of the Hearts".
